Bata India Q1 Results: Profit jumps 23% to Rs 64 crore on operational efficiency

Bata India has reported a remarkable twenty-three percent increase in profits for the June quarter, thanks to effective operational efficiency and stringent cost management. In addition, a four percent growth in revenue from operations was fueled by premiumization and higher sales volume. The company has also announced an interim dividend of twenty-five rupees per share, marking its third consecutive quarter of impressive growth.
